The Analog Signal Sampling and Reconstruction Kit is a comprehensive communication laboratory trainer designed to demonstrate the principles of analog signal sampling, aliasing, and accurate signal reconstruction. This kit enables students to practically verify the Nyquist sampling theorem and study the effects of under-sampling, over-sampling, and proper low-pass filtering on signal recovery.
